About the Cruise

New Orleans is a beautiful place, and guests can cherish its interesting architecture and beautiful skyline from the waters of the Mississippi River aboard the Riverboat City of New Orleans Jazz Cruises. Climb aboard the beautiful boat, the newest addition to the Steamboat Natchez family. Steamboat Natchez's sister boat brings a new air of fun to NOLA. The boat itself is absolutely gorgeous and expansive, providing plenty of deck space for visiting with other guests, marveling at the New Orleans sights, and for enjoying the brilliant jazz-themed live entertainment. There are multiple decks to peruse, each offering its own glorious view of the French Quarter from the Mississippi River. While you aren't sightseeing, you will be able to enjoy some amazing live jazz music. This energetic atmosphere will help you make the most out of your travels to New Orleans.

About the Meal

It wouldn't be a cruise on the Riverboat City of New Orleans without the amazing meal! The on-board chefs create a perfect menu that exemplifies the flavors of New Orleans while providing a delicious experience to guests. The menus vary but each of them are curated so you can sample a little bit of everything. Each spread is infused with the flavors, culture, and history that make New Orleans unique. From Southern-fried fish to red beans and rice, jambalaya, and decadent white chocolate bread pudding to top it all off, these dishes offer plenty of flavor! The boat also operates a cash-only bar, so guests can sip cocktails and their favorite brews with their meal.

Frequently Asked Questions for Riverboat City of New Orleans :
  • What is included in the admission price for the cruise?
    The cruise is included in all prices. A meal is included if you choose one of those cruise options.
  • Approximately how long could a customer plan to spend on the cruise?
    The cruises last approximately two hours.
  • What should I wear?
    All of the cruises are casual attire.
  • Is photography & video recording allowed?
    Of course. Don't forget your cameras!
  • For what ages is Riverboat City of New Orleans appropriate?
    It's appropriate for all ages.
  • Is parking available?
    There are parking lots on Decatur Street that offer hourly rates on parking.
  • What methods of transportation does the Riverboat City of New Orleans use?
    Boat.
  • Approximately how long does the Riverboat City of New Orleans last?
    It lasts approximately 2 hours.
  • For what ages is the tour appropriate?
    Great for all ages.
  • What type of dress & footwear are recommended?
    Casual professional attire.
  • Is photography / video recording allowed on the Riverboat City of New Orleans ?
    Yes.
  • Is the Riverboat City of New Orleans handicap accessible?
    Yes, although access to the top & bottom decks is by stairs only.
  • How many decks or levels are there aboard the Riverboat City of New Orleans ?
    There are 3 decks.
  • What lake or river does the Riverboat City of New Orleans cruise on?
    Mississippi River.
